The smart legend setting moves repeated text items from the legend into a legend header, making the legend easier to read.

Enabling the Smart legend setting
The Smart legend setting is currently disabled by default, but will be enabled by default in newly created charts at a later date.
To enable the Smart legend setting:
Enter the Series setting of your chart
Go to the Axis and Legend entries panel.
Click the "Position repeated legend labels in legend headers" button.
Legend position setting
The repeated text is always positioned above the chart, and is not affected by the "legend position" setting.
In the below example the "legend position" is "right" but the header still shows above the chart.
